PRINCIPAL EVENTS IN LIFE: At the age of 12 Jack moved from Cicero, IL with his family to the Stetsonville, WI and later moved to Medford. During High School Jack participated in Golden Glove Boxing in Marshfield and Milwaukee and after graduating from Medford High School he signed with the Philadelphia Phillies and the Kansas City Royals as a Minor League Shortstop. In 1958 he began working at Adolph’s Barber Shop in Colby and then in 1960 he began working at Wally’s Barber Shop in Medford until his retirement in 2007. Jack was a lifelong fan of bowling, golfing, baseball and football. He refereed many basketball games throughout Northern Wisconsin. Jack was a fun loving husband, father, and grandfather. He enjoyed life to the fullest.
